<div class="gmail_quote">On Fri, Jan 23, 2009 at 1:05 AM, Derek Atkins <span dir="ltr">&lt;<a href="mailto:warlord@mit.edu" target="_blank">warlord@mit.edu</a>&gt;</span> wrote:<br><blockquote class="gmail_quote" style="border-left: 1px solid rgb(204, 204, 204); margin: 0pt 0pt 0pt 0.8ex; padding-left: 1ex;">

Hey rpm-ers,<br>
<br>
I&#39;m trying to create an RPM package that contains other RPM<br>
packages and installs those sub-packages as part of the %post<br>
script. &nbsp; However when I try this I get a lock failure:<br>
<br>
warning: waiting for transaction lock on /var/lib/rpm/__db.000<br>
<br>
Is there some way to do a recursive RPM install?<br>
<br>
For more details:<br>
<br>
When you run &quot;rpm -U foo.rpm&quot; it installs a bunch of RPM files.<br>
So foo.rpm installs /usr/lib/foo/packages/foo-{1,2,3}.rpm<br>
Then in the foo.rpm %post script I want to:<br>
<br>
 &nbsp;rpm -U foo-1.rpm foo-2.rpm foo-3.rpm<br>
<br>
Is there a good way to do this?<br>
<br>
Thanks in advance!<br>
</blockquote><div><br>I hope that, for @<a href="http://rpm.org">rpm.org</a> policy, i can post this ref <br><br><a href="http://lists.rpm.org/pipermail/rpm-list/2008-December/000075.html">http://lists.rpm.org/pipermail/rpm-list/2008-December/000075.html</a><br>
<br>on the subject. <br><br></div><blockquote class="gmail_quote" style="border-left: 1px solid rgb(204, 204, 204); margin: 0pt 0pt 0pt 0.8ex; padding-left: 1ex;"><br>

-derek<br>
<br>
--<br>
<font color="#888888"> &nbsp; &nbsp; &nbsp; Derek Atkins, SB &#39;93 MIT EE, SM &#39;95 MIT Media Laboratory<br>
 &nbsp; &nbsp; &nbsp; Member, MIT Student Information Processing Board &nbsp;(SIPB)<br>
 &nbsp; &nbsp; &nbsp; URL: <a href="http://web.mit.edu/warlord/" target="_blank">http://web.mit.edu/warlord/</a> &nbsp; &nbsp;PP-ASEL-IA &nbsp; &nbsp; N1NWH<br>
 &nbsp; &nbsp; &nbsp; <a href="mailto:warlord@MIT.EDU" target="_blank">warlord@MIT.EDU</a> &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p;PGP key available<br>
_______________________________________________<br>
Rpm-list mailing list<br>
<a href="mailto:Rpm-list@lists.rpm.org" target="_blank">Rpm-list@lists.rpm.org</a><br>
<a href="http://lists.rpm.org/mailman/listinfo/rpm-list" target="_blank">http://lists.rpm.org/mailman/listinfo/rpm-list</a><br>
</font></blockquote></div><br>